Position Overview
The Maintenance Engineer is responsible for the operation, maintenance, service and repair of equipment. The role completes maintenance request work orders from all departments promptly and assists in the repair, maintenance, upkeep, and replacement of the property's cosmetic materials (interior/exterior painting, patching of woodwork, furniture refinishing) in accordance with hotel standards, also supporting other Engineering areas as needed.

Job Duties
Safely perform highly complex repairs of the physical property, electrical, plumbing, and mechanical equipment, air conditioners, refrigeration and pool heaters, ensuring all methods, materials and practices meet company, local, and national codes with minimal supervision.
Perform routine inspections and ensure equipment complies with safety standards.
Use advanced knowledge of commercial building systems and maintenance tools.
Bring demonstrated experience as a Mechanical/Maintenance Engineer in the hotel industry.
Proficiently troubleshoot issues and execute repairs promptly.
Strong problem‑solving aptitude.
Excellent communication and interpersonal skills for effective collaboration.
Physical capability to handle and move heavy equipment as needed.
Adhere to property guidelines to ensure health, safety, and comfort of team members and guests.
Knowledge of proper chemical handling and disposal.
Ability to prioritize tasks and meet work assignment deadlines.
Utilize PPE in accordance with property guidelines.
Manage guest requests, inquiries, and complaints promptly and follow‑up to maintain high guest satisfaction.
Carry out regular maintenance tasks and thorough inspections to uphold operational integrity of hotel systems.
Maintain accurate maintenance logs and monitor inventory of supplies.
Troubleshoot and repair all types of equipment (e.g., pump and motor replacement, plumbing, electrical, cosmetic items, extension cords, vacuum cleaners, internet devices) and program TVs, using lockout/tagout before work.
Operate safely with hand and power tools, report hazards, and safely store flammable materials.
Ensure work area is clean and free of hazards.
Support setup and dismantling of equipment for hotel events as required.
Perform any other job‑related duties as assigned.
Execute Engineer on Duty responsibilities, including readings and rounds.
Position Requirements
Interpret manufacturer's literature for installation, preparation, use, and upkeep of various materials and products used throughout the property.
Prioritize tasks and meet deadlines.
Frequently stand, walk, sit, stoop, twist, push, pull, and use power and hand tools.
Lift or move up to 50 pounds routinely and up to 75 pounds occasionally.
